United Community Banks, Inc. Announces Quarterly Cash Dividend
February 12, 2015 11:45 AM ESTBLAIRSVILLE, Ga., Feb. 12, 2015 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- United Community Banks, Inc. (Nasdaq: UCBI), reported that its Board of Directors declared a regular quarterly cash dividend of five cents per common share. The dividend is payable April 1, 2015, to shareholders of record on March 15, 2015.
